The Importance of FAQs and Self-Help Tools

F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ions) are a valuable resource for businesses, finance professionals, and investors. They provide answers to common queries and can help save time for both the reader and the business. By addressing frequently asked questions upfront, you can reduce the number of inquiries received and provide a better user experience for your audience.

Self-help tools, on the other hand, offer interactive resources that allow readers to find answers to their questions on their own. These tools can include calculators, guides, tutorials, and more. By providing self-help tools, you empower your audience to take control of their own learning and decision-making process.

Overall, FAQs and self-help tools can help build trust with your audience, establish your expertise in your field, and improve the overall user experience on your website.

Tips for Developing FAQs and Self-Help Tools

When developing FAQs and self-help tools for your business, finance, or investor readers, it’s important to keep the following tips in mind:

1. Identify Common Questions and Pain Points

Start by identifying the most common questions and pain points that your audience may have. This can be done through customer surveys, analytics data, or direct feedback. By understanding what your audience is struggling with, you can tailor your FAQs and self-help tools to address their specific needs.

2. Keep It Simple and User-Friendly

When creating FAQs and self-help tools, it’s important to keep them simple and easy to navigate. Use clear language, organize information logically, and provide clear instructions on how to use the tools. Remember that your audience may not be experts in your field, so it’s important to make the information accessible to all levels of knowledge.

3. Update and Maintain Regularly

As your business, finance, or investor landscape evolves, so too will the questions and needs of your audience. It’s important to regularly update and maintain your FAQs and self-help tools to ensure that they remain relevant and accurate. Consider setting up a schedule for reviewing and updating your resources to keep them current.
